﻿var modernhlightbluedateformat;
var modernhlightbluelocale;
var modernhlightbluenights;

Date.prototype.addDays = function (days) {
    this.setDate(this.getDate() + days);
}

$(document).ready(function () {

    modernhlightbluedateformat = $('#modern-h-lightblue-df').val();
    modernhlightbluelocale = $('#modern-h-lightblue-locale').val();
    modernhlightbluenights = parseInt($('#modern-h-lightblue-nights').val());
    $.datepicker.setDefaults($.datepicker.regional[modernhlightbluelocale]);

    $("#modern-h-lightblue-ci").datepicker({
        showOn: "button",
        buttonImage: "http://www.geobookings.com/data/forms/modern-h-lightblue/images/calendar.jpg",
        buttonImageOnly: true,
        changeMonth: true,
        changeYear: true,
        minDate: 0,
        dateFormat: modernhlightbluedateformat,
        onSelect: function (dateText, inst) {
            sDate = $("#modern-h-lightblue-ci").datepicker("getDate");
            sDate.addDays(modernhlightbluenights);
            $("#modern-h-lightblue-co").datepicker("setDate", sDate);
        }
    });
    $("#modern-h-lightblue-ci").datepicker($.datepicker.regional[modernhlightbluelocale]).datepicker("setDate", "+0d");

    $("#modern-h-lightblue-co").datepicker({
        showOn: "button",
        buttonImage: "http://www.geobookings.com/data/forms/modern-h-lightblue/images/calendar.jpg",
        buttonImageOnly: true,
        changeMonth: true,
        minDate: 1,
        changeYear: true,
        dateFormat: modernhlightbluedateformat
    });
    $("#modern-h-lightblue-co").datepicker($.datepicker.regional[modernhlightbluelocale]).datepicker("setDate", "+" + modernhlightbluenights + "d");

    $("#modern-h-lightblue-go").click(function () {
        var id = $('#modern-h-lightblue-id').val();
        var lid = $('#modern-h-lightblue-lid').val();
        var interface = $('#modern-h-lightblue-interface').val();
        var theme = $('#modern-h-lightblue-theme').val();
        var ci = $('#modern-h-lightblue-ci').val();
        var co = $('#modern-h-lightblue-co').val();
        var windowname = "geobooking" + id;
        window.open(interface + '?id=' + id + '&ci=' + ci + '&co=' + co + "&th=" + theme + "&l=" + lid, windowname, 'width=996,height=718,scrollbars=no,status=yes,resizable=no');
    });

});
